Insular Life Corporate Center, Ayala Alabang, Muntinlupa City/10-11 July 2009
Mr Mark Parco, the Director of the Pricing Administration Center of the American President Lines (APL), invited the Team Bald Runner to conduct a Running Clinic to its staff & subordinates through the efforts of Mr Allan Martin who consistently acted on the details of this activity. After coordination through e-mails, a Running Clinic was conducted to the employees of the said office at the Seminar Room “B”, Tower 1, at the Insular Life Center Building at Filinvest City in Ayala Alabang.
The running clinic was divided into two phases, a lecture and an actual demonstration of running, exercises, and drills to the participants. The lecture on the Basics and Principles of Running was conducted at 3:00-5:00PM last July 10 and the actual demonstration and practical exercises were done the following day at 6:00-9:00 AM, July 11.
The lecture was attended by almost 40 employees to include Mr Mark Parco and wife, Tiffin, who are competitive runners who are permanent “fixtures” and participants of weekly road races in Metro Manila. The lecture of the Bald Runner was complemented with more explanations and examples from Mr Parco as he was a former Captain of the UP Diliman Track Team. It was a very fruitful lecture to every employee.



On the following day, members of the Elite Team Bald Runner helped in the conduct of the actual demonstration and practical exercises in running. The participants were made to warm-up through jogging, did some stretching exercises, ran along the roads of the Filinvest City, did some running drills, and finally, did a short competition of a shuttle run where the group was divided into three groups. The actual demonstration and practical exercises on running were highly appreciatedby the employees as they requested from their Director the conduct of running activities at least two times a week among them. The Director, in return, voluntarily promised to provide them with a running program for them to finish at least a 5K road race and that he will support their registration fees.
